Transaction 32baf78125916686fd6904fec58c473029ac43a506e10008c96124012a6afdea

2 Input
2 Outputs
  • 32baf78125916686fd6904fec58c473029ac43a506e10008c96124012a6afdea:0
  • value  250000000
    address  1DKxhLra1xLPvqT6mXVQUBLkmqANkdLt4f
  • 32baf78125916686fd6904fec58c473029ac43a506e10008c96124012a6afdea:1
  • value  175612496
    address  1G2jsfSLq2gehFxoFCnUrCLD27uLSNEsi2